Cetrorelix Acetate Injection is a synthetic decapeptide that belongs to the class of gonadotropin-releasing hormone (GnRH) antagonists. It competitively binds to receptors on the pituitary cell membrane with endogenous GnRH, thereby inhibiting pituitary secretion of luteinizing hormone (LH) and follicle stimulating hormone (FSH), and this inhibitory effect is dose-dependent. GnRH typically binds to GnRH receptors on the surface of pituitary gonadotropin cells, stimulating the secretion of LH and FSH. Acetic acid cetuximab has a similar structure to GnRH and can competitively bind to these receptors, thereby blocking the action of GnRH. It can inhibit pituitary secretion of LH and FSH by blocking the action of GnRH. This inhibitory effect appears rapidly after medication, and continuous treatment can maintain the inhibitory effect.

Pharmacological effects of Cetrorelix Acetate
Cetrorelix Acetate is a synthetic decapeptide that belongs to the GnRH antagonist class. GnRH is a hormone secreted by the hypothalamus that binds to the GnRH receptor on the membrane of anterior pituitary cells, stimulating the pituitary gland to secrete luteinizing hormone (LH) and follicle stimulating hormone (FSH). LH and FSH play a crucial role in the female reproductive cycle, with LH peak triggering egg maturation and ovulation, while FSH promotes follicle development and estrogen synthesis.
It can competitively bind to receptors on the pituitary cell membrane with endogenous GnRH, thereby blocking the stimulating effect of GnRH on the pituitary gland and inhibiting the secretion of LH and FSH. This inhibitory effect is dose-dependent, meaning that the higher the drug dosage, the stronger the inhibitory effect on LH and FSH secretion. Unlike GnRH agonists, it does not have an initial stimulatory effect and can rapidly produce inhibitory effects after medication, and continuous treatment can maintain this inhibitory effect.
During the natural menstrual cycle, follicle development to a certain stage triggers LH peaks, leading to egg maturation and ovulation. However, in the controlled ovarian stimulation (COS) process of assisted reproductive technology, premature LH peak can lead to premature rupture of follicles, resulting in decreased egg quality or inability to obtain a sufficient number of mature eggs, thereby reducing fertilization and pregnancy rates. Cetrorelix Acetate Injection can delay the appearance of LH peak by inhibiting LH secretion, ensuring that follicles reach optimal maturity under the control of doctors and providing high-quality eggs for subsequent egg retrieval and in vitro fertilization.
Pharmacokinetic characteristics
After subcutaneous injection, the substance has a high bioavailability of approximately 85%. The total plasma clearance rate and renal clearance rate were 1.2ml/min/kg and 0.1ml/min/kg, respectively, with a distribution volume (Vd) of 1.1l/kg. The average terminal half lives after intravenous injection and subcutaneous injection are approximately 12 hours and 30 hours, respectively. The pharmacokinetics of single subcutaneous administration (0.25mg-3mg cetuximab) and continuous daily administration for 14 days showed linearity, providing a basis for dose adjustment in clinical medication.
Specific uses in assisted reproductive technology
In the COS process of assisted reproductive technology, it is usually necessary to use gonadotropins (such as FSH, HMG, etc.) to stimulate the simultaneous development of multiple follicles to increase the number of retrieved eggs. However, the occurrence of endogenous LH peak during follicular development is a potential risk. This substance can effectively prevent premature ovulation and ensure egg retrieval at the appropriate time by inhibiting LH secretion. For example, in in in vitro fertilization embryo transfer therapy, doctors will start using gonadotropins for ovarian stimulation at specific times during the menstrual cycle based on the patient's specific condition. When the diameter of the dominant follicle reaches 14-16mm, inject an injection containing this substance once a day until 24-36 hours before ovulation induction. This can ensure that follicles continue to develop and mature under the action of gonadotropins, while avoiding premature ovulation caused by LH peak.
Reduce the risk of ovarian hyperstimulation syndrome (OHSS)
OHSS is one of the common complications in assisted reproductive technology, mainly manifested as ovarian hyperresponsiveness, causing symptoms such as ascites, pleural effusion, blood concentration, electrolyte imbalance, and even life-threatening in severe cases. The occurrence of OHSS is related to the excessive response of the ovaries to gonadotropins and the stimulation of LH peaks. Cetrorelix Acetate Injection reduces the risk of OHSS by suppressing LH peaks and reducing ovarian overreaction to gonadotropins. Research has shown that compared to GnRH agonist regimens, the use of Cetrorelix antagonist regimens can reduce the incidence of moderate to severe OHSS from 3.2% to 1.1%, significantly improving the safety of treatment.
A stable hormonal environment is crucial for the normal development and maturation of eggs. During ovulation induction, hormone fluctuations caused by LH peak may affect the quality of eggs. It can maintain stable hormone levels, avoid the adverse effects of LH peak, and help improve the quality of eggs. High quality eggs are a key factor in improving fertilization rates and embryo quality, thereby increasing the chances of successful pregnancy. Clinical data shows that using this product can increase the average number of retrieved eggs by 15% -20%, and significantly improve the maturity and quality of eggs.
Reduce the risk of multiple pregnancies
Multiple pregnancy is another important issue of assisted reproductive technology. It not only increases the risk of pregnancy for pregnant women, such as hypertensive disorder during pregnancy, diabetes, postpartum hemorrhage, etc., but also has adverse effects on the health of newborns, such as premature delivery, low birth weight, neonatal asphyxia, etc. It reduces the risk of multiple pregnancies by precisely controlling the development of follicles, thereby reducing the likelihood of multiple follicles maturing simultaneously. This helps to improve the safety of assisted reproductive technology and ensure maternal and infant health.
The receptivity of the endometrium is crucial for embryo implantation. In assisted reproductive technology, stable hormone levels help maintain the good condition of the endometrium and provide a suitable environment for embryo implantation. This substance can improve the receptivity of the endometrium and increase the success rate of embryo implantation by stabilizing hormone levels.
Frequently Asked Questions
What is cetrorelix acetate used for?

Cetrorelix is used to prevent premature ovulation as part of controlled ovarian stimulation treatment. The content of 1 vial (0.25 mg) is administered once a day every 24 hours. In individual cases, it can also be given twice a day at intervals of 12 hours.
How effective is cetrorelix injection?

In conclusion, a daily cetrorelix injection (0.25 mg) is able to prevent premature LH surge under the letrozole-FSH protocol but is not fully efficient. The beneficial effect for IUI treatment in terms of pregnancy rate needs to be further elucidated.
What happens after a cetrorelix injection?

Common side effects include pain, discoloration or redness, or swelling at the injection site. Nausea and headache can also occur. Cetrorelix is an injection that you will give yourself after training from your healthcare provider.
